Understanding Impermanent Loss

Before diving into stablecoin strategies, it’s crucial to grasp the concept of Impermanent Loss (IL). IL occurs when you provide liquidity to a decentralized exchange (DEX) liquidity pool, and the price ratio of the tokens in that pool changes. The larger the price divergence, the greater the potential IL. It’s called “impermanent” because the loss only becomes realized if you withdraw your liquidity. If the price ratio reverts to its original state, the loss disappears.

The core issue stems from the DEX’s mechanism for maintaining a constant product. Liquidity pools commonly use the formula x * y = k, where x and y represent the quantities of the two tokens in the pool, and k is a constant. When the external market price of one token increases, arbitrageurs will trade in the pool to rebalance it towards the market price. This trading activity is what causes liquidity providers (LPs) to experience IL.

Stablecoin Pools: A Lower-Risk Liquidity Provisioning Option

Stablecoin pools, such as those pairing USDT with USDC, DAI, or other stablecoins, are significantly less susceptible to impermanent loss compared to pools containing volatile assets like Bitcoin (BTC) or Ethereum (ETH). Why? Because stablecoins are *designed* to maintain a 1:1 peg to a fiat currency, typically the US dollar. This minimal price fluctuation reduces the arbitrage activity that drives IL.

However, it's important to note that even stablecoin pools aren't entirely immune. De-pegging events (where a stablecoin loses its 1:1 peg) can lead to IL. Furthermore, smart contract risks and platform vulnerabilities remain. Always research the stablecoins and platforms you're using.
